Modification of the shortest path search algorithms in the transport network telecommunication system of geoinformation transmission

Annotation

The authors propose a modified algorithm to find vertex-independent paths in the information direction of the transport network telecommunication system of geoinformation transmission. To improve the structural stability of streaming transport network together accounted for a connection coefficients geoinformation flows vertex-independent paths, the system clock signal and the network synchronization system of uniform time for edge-independent paths. Specified number of edge-independent signaling pathways of the clock network synchronization and timing system is determined by the modified algorithm developed by Prima. The use of these algorithms in the synthesis of the structure of the telecommunications transport network of geoinformation transmission system can improve its structural stability in the 1,5-2,7 times.
